Sitkum Duhamel fire 30% contained

There is still no time frame for the lifting of the Evacuation Alert for more than 350 homes affected by the Sitkum-Duhamel Creek wildfire.

But things are now rated as 30% contained.

More personnel joined the action over the weekend.

There are 125 fire-fighters working on building guards and doing burn-outs.

An Access Restriction Order remains in place and anyone defying that can face a fine of up to $5,000.
